Output 7c59afda2628b76dc2d292c71a20a83eba82417ebb843b00e7786fadc01cdaae:2

value
2047201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ad8faeef182365cdd87a554e24b391b18f9728 OP_EQUAL
address
3B3vmMjzdjbHDPQPX7xzVGsyczVUePtRNm
transaction
7c59afda2628b76dc2d292c71a20a83eba82417ebb843b00e7786fadc01cdaae
spent
true